Reader Feedback on Zeiss 21mm f/2.8 Distagon
Reader Kit F writes:
Last December I asked for advice on the Zeiss 21mm wide. Your advice was very helpful to me. It is a great lens.
I was able to shoot the Amphitheater in Aspendos, Turkey with the 21mm. It clearly took some great pictures there. The 21mm, Canon 50L and Zeiss 100mm have become my go to lenses for general photography. My thanks for your letters and input.
Jeff C writes:
Your blog and guides are wonderful to read. I do enjoy reading about the Zeiss lenses and especially like to read the lens comparisons.
I purchased the Zeiss ZE 2.8/21mm lens a few months ago and marvel each time I use it. It has such a wide field of view and is so sharp I've had to learn how to use it affectively. Used on my 5D Mark II, I couldn't be happier. (unless it was a f/2.0)
I do believe that the Zeiss 21mm f/2.8 Distagon (reviewed in my Guide) is one of the finest wide angle lenses ever produced, and I heartily recommend it to anyone for which manual focus is acceptable.
